Evidence-based Social Work

Gray, Mel / Plath, Debbie / Webb, Stephen
Evidence-based Social Work
Provides a critical analysis of evidence-based practice in social work. This book introduces readers to the research, policy, legislative, and practice context. It discusses what constitutes knowledge in social work, the values and beliefs that lie behind EBP and problems of implementation, formalisation and resource management.
